The legend Bob Dylan is in talks with director Martin Scorsese to direct a sequel to just released documentary No Direction Home.

According to ananova.com, executive producer Sandra Levy says that preliminary talks are already taking place.
She said: ""We are having preliminary discussions about that. We are researching that right now. There's not as much material and it's not as dense as the material we had from the sixties. There are big gaps in it."
The documentary featured Dylan talking at length about his life for the first time which followed his career up till 1966.
